Page 215 - point source" means any discernible, confined and discrete conveyance, including but not limited to any pipe, ditch, channel, tunnel, conduit, well, discrete fissure, container, rolling stock, concentrated animal feeding operation, or vessel or other floating craft, from which pollutants are or may be discharged.

Page 33 - For the purposes of this act the term "conviction" shall mean a final conviction. Also, for the purposes of this act a forfeiture of bail or collateral deposited to secure a defendant's appearance in court, which forfeiture has not been vacated, shall be equivalent to a conviction.

(a) The Criteria of Adverse Effect on eligible properties may occur under conditions which include but are not limited to: (1) Destruction or alteration of all or part of a property. (2) Isolation from or alteration of the property's surrounding environment. (3) Transfer or sale of a property without adequate conditions or restrictions regarding preservation, maintenance, or use.
